How to Make Buttermilk Biscuits

  1. Preheat your oven to 450°F (230°C) and line your ba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Mix dry ingredients — In a large b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  3. Cut in butter — Use your fingertips or a pastry cutter until it looks like coarse crumbs with little butter bits.
  4. Add buttermilk — Stir gently until dough just comes together (don’t overmix — this keeps them fluffy).
  5. Shape & fold — Turn the dough onto a floured surface. Gently pat into a 1-inch-thick rectangle. Fold it over itself 2–3 times for layers.
  6. Cut biscuits — Use a round cutter and place them close for soft sides, or spaced apart for crisp edges.
  7. Bake for 12–15 minutes until golden brown.
  8. Brush with melted butter right after baking and enjoy warm with your favorite toppings.

Tips for Perfect Results

  1. Keep it cold: Cold butter = flaky layers. Always chill before baking.
  2. Fold, don’t knead: Folding adds air and structure. Too much kneading makes them dense.
  3. Use sharp cutters: Dull edges seal layers and stop them from rising tall.

Storage Instructions

Store leftover biscuits in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days. For longer storage, refrigerate for 5 days or freeze up to 3 months. Reheat in the oven at 350°F for 5–7 minutes — they’ll taste freshly baked again.
